My guest this week is Kyle-Steven Porter, artist, podcaster and event coordinator. Kyle is the Diversity Lounge Manager for PAX and a board member for Flame Con, the world’s largest queer comic con.

Through Geeks OUT, a 501(c)(3) non-profit that seeks to rally, promote, and empower the queer geek community, Kyle attends conventions, coordinates queer spaces at other events, and helps producing Flame Con – a two-day comics, arts and entertainment expo, showcasing creators and special guests from all corners of the LGBTQ fandom. It features thoughtful discussions, exclusive performances, screenings, cosplay and more!
